İçerik:
Front Cover; Current Topics in Membranes and Transport, Volume 5; Copyright Page; Contents; List of Contributors; Preface; Contents of Previous Volumes; Chapter 1. Cation Transport in Bacteria: K+, Na+, and H+; I. Introduction; II. The Ion Balance of Bacterial Cells; III. Ionophores; IV. Membrane Potential and Proton Transport; V. Transport of K+ and Na+; VI. Cation Transport and Cell Functions; References; Chapter 2. Pro and Contra Carrier Proteins; Sugar Transport via the Periplasmic Galactose-Binding Protein; I. Introduction; II. Properties of the MeGal Transport System
III. Properties of the Galactose-Binding ProteinIV. Evidence for the Essential Function of the Galactose- Binding Protein in the Transport Mechanism of the MeGal Transport System; V. The Involvement of the Galactose-Binding Protein in Chemotaxis; VI. Regulation of the MeGal System and of the Galactose- Binding Protein Synthesis by Events Occurring during the Bacterial Cell Cycle; VII. Pro and Contra Carrier Funrtion of Periplasmic Binding Proteins; References; Chapter 3. Coupling and Energy Transfer in Active Amino Acid Transport; I. Introduction
II. The Quasi-Chemical Notation of Irreversible ThermodynamicsIII. The Coupling of Amino Acid Transport to lon Flows; References; Chapter 4. The Means of Distinguishing between Hydrogen Secretion and Bicarbonate Reabsorption: Theory and Applications to the Reptilian Bladder and Mammalian Kidney; Preface; I. General Considerations; II. Acidification of the Luminal Fluid by the Turtle Bladder; III. The Renal Mechanism of Acidification; References; Chapter 5. Sodium and Chloride Transport across Isolated Rabbit Ileum; I. Introduction; II. A Working Model of the Small Intestinal Epithelium
III. The Shunt Pathway in Isolated Rabbit IleumIV. Transepithelial Transport of Na and Cl across in Vivo and in Vitro Preparations of Ileal Mucosa; V. Influxes of Na and Cl across the Brush Border; VI. Solute-Coupled Transport; VII. Ion Transport and the Electrophysiology of Rabbit Ileum; VIII. Concluding Remarks; References; Chapter 6. A Macromolecular Approach to Nerve Excitation; I. Introduction; II. Abrupt Depolarization; III. Instability and Excitability of the Axon Membrane; IV. Interactions between Membrane Macromolecules and Small Ions; V. Optical Studies of Excitable Membranes
VI. Fluorescence StudiesVII. Summary; References; Subject Index
